NYC Council allocates $1.2 Million to support migrant communities
New York City Council finds money to spend supporting non-profits supporting migrants. On Wednesday, the announcement was made to give $1.2 million to these organizations. Council Speaker Adrienne Adams made the announcement. She said the money was pulled from another initiative called the Department of Youth and Community Development (DYCD). This was leftover money and needed to be spent as the fiscal year for The City ends in four months.

President Biden Made a $292 Million Contribution to New York and it's Not For Migrants
President Joe Biden stopped in New York City on Tuesday to announce $292 Million in funding for the Hudson Tunnel Project that connects New York City and New Jersey. A White House official said a new tunnel will be built that connects Palisades, the Hudson River, and the waterfront area in Manhattan.

New York City Migrants Complain About Living Conditions at a Free Shelter
Over the weekend, New York City started to move migrants from one location to another. What should have been an easy process wasn’t. Some migrants refused to leave Watson Hotel which was provided exclusively for men and free of charge. The migrants were slated to move into another shelter - the Brooklyn Cruise Terminal.
